
A 23-year-old woman, Rabi’a Labaran, has been arrested by the Katsina State Police for allegedly stabbing her co-wife, Zainab Lawal, to death during a domestic altercation in Daura.
- The incident occurred behind Dadi Primary School in Sabon Gari, Daura.
- The victim was found by her husband in a pool of blood after returning from the market.
- Police rushed her to FMC Daura, but she was confirmed dead on arrival.
- The suspect confessed to stabbing during a scuffle after a misunderstanding.
- Police say investigation is ongoing; CP Bello Shehu warns against domestic violence.
